Dubai property developer Meraas has launched The Edit at d3, a new residential project located in the heart of Dubai Design District (d3).
The development marks a significant addition to the district’s next phase of growth, introducing new homes along the Dubai Canal waterfront.
The Edit at d3 comprises three towers positioned along the canal promenade, adjacent to the recently launched Atélis at d3.

In total, the project will feature 557 contemporary residences, ranging from one- to four-bedroom apartments to signature penthouses.
Designed as a bold architectural statement, the towers incorporate softened forms, curved corners and flowing balcony lines.
Elevated sky gardens are integrated throughout the buildings, bringing natural light and greenery into communal areas, with landscaped terraces, wellness sanctuaries and social lounges forming part of the vertical urban layout.
Residents will have access to a wide range of amenities, including:
- Resort-style pools
- Co-working areas
- Creative studios
- Family and kids’ zones
- Health club with yoga and fitness spaces
- Gaming lounges
- Private cinema
The development also offers direct access to d3’s waterfront promenades, cafés, galleries and fashion ateliers.

The launch coincides with d3’s wider expansion programme, which will increase the district’s built-up area by approximately 500,000 sqft. The next phase will introduce new creative industries, cultural venues and dining destinations, positioning residents of The Edit at d3 at the centre of one of the region’s most active and fast-evolving design ecosystems.
